Ducati is going to launch the new scrambler 1100 pro BS 6 on the 22nd of this month. This bike will be the second bike from Ducati that is going to be on sale India with BS 6 emission norms after Ducati Panigale V4. There are two variants expected to arrive in India, One is scrambler pro and sports pro version.
both the bike shares the platform and powered by the same 1079 cc Ltwin air-cooled engine that delivers 86hp @ 7500 RPM and max. torque of 88 Nm @ 4550 RPM. both the bikes are similar in power configuration but there is a big difference of styling, riding position and suspension.

In 1100 sports pro gets a lower handlebar like a cafe racer and equipped with an Ohlins suspension. On the other hand,1100 pro gets Marzocchi front fork and kayaba mono-shock. moving towards price, the company hasn’t given any hint but we expect it will be approximately 1.5 Lakhs more costly than the BS 4 Variant.
